WebAug 24, 2016 · On every UDP socket, there’s a “socket send buffer” that you put packets into. The Linux kernel deals with those packets and sends them out as quickly as possible. So if you have a network card that’s too slow or something, it’s possible that it will not be able to send the packets as fast as you put them in! So you will drop packets. WebJan 5, 2024 · How do I test for packet loss? The most commonly-used utility to test for packet loss is Ping. this tool will send packets to a specific destination and report if a response failed to arrive. A missing packet could mean that the request that was sent got lost or that the reply was lost.
